Transaction 7916ef18b797048e8ffc1e278e032f1964bd39e25f41de96c856467340051084
4 Input
2 Outputs
- 7916ef18b797048e8ffc1e278e032f1964bd39e25f41de96c856467340051084:0
- 7916ef18b797048e8ffc1e278e032f1964bd39e25f41de96c856467340051084:1
value 45199
address 1BFoJocKKqRhWizF3SJBtDyVRW16AGn1jF
value 3391769
address 14Dh4Z8bipBzAwPPdximrEbPwqk7RBicBm